Act No. 3184 is an act amending Section 2126 of Act No. 2711 (Administrative Code) to provide for the maintenance and allowances of professional students from provinces studying in the University of the Philippines or other governmental educational institutions.

Section twenty-one hundred and twenty-six (Section 2126) of Act Numbered 2711, known as the Administrative Code, is amended by Act No. 3184.

Any provincial board has the power to appropriate the necessary amount for one or two permanent allowances for students who are residents of the province.

The allowance shall not exceed forty pesos a month.

One or two students who are residents of the province may receive the allowance.

The provisions apply to students studying in the University of the Philippines or any governmental educational institution.

Students are entitled to reimbursement of actual and necessary traveling and subsistence expenses from their residence to their place of study and vice versa at least once each school year; matriculation and graduation fees, if any; reimbursement of the cost of books required for each course; and free admission and treatment at the Philippine General Hospital in case of illness.

Students are entitled to be admitted into and treated in the Philippine General Hospital free of charge in case of illness.

The Act took effect upon its approval on November 27, 1924.
